Costs & Financial Aid

In-state tuition at Utah State University is $9,228 and out-of-state tuition is $24,802. After financial aid, the average net price is $14,936. About 25.8% of students receive Pell Grants.

Outcomes & Earnings

Graduates of Utah State University earn a median salary of $54,022 ten years after enrollment. The graduation rate is 58.2%. Median student debt at graduation is $14,340, with an estimated monthly loan payment of $152.

Student Body

Utah State University has 20,272 undergraduate students. The student body is 55.0% female. About 28.4% are first-generation college students. The average age at entry is 23.2.
